Citrix Server Detection
Citrix servers allow a Windows user to remotely obtain a graphical login and therefore act as a local user on the remote host. NOTE: by default the Citrix Server application utilizes a weak 40 bit obfuscation algorithm not even a true encryption. If the default settings have not been changed, the...

CVE-1999-1104
CVE-1999-1104 affects Windows 95 password caching: the .pwl file is encrypted with weak protection, enabling a local attacker to decrypt cached passwords and potentially gain privileges. The available documents do not specify remediation or fixes; exploitation details are not provided.

CVE-1999-1104
Windows 95 uses weak encryption for the password list .pwl file used when password caching is enabled, which allows local users to gain privileges by decrypting the passwords...
